Description
Greenwich Radiological Group (GRG) is a 9 person physician-owned private practice group in Greenwich, CT seeking both a fellowship trained breast/body imager and neuroradiologist/general radiologist for partner-track or employee positions. Fellows finishing in June 2026 are welcome to apply.
We provide radiology services for Greenwich Hospital (GH)–a 206-bed community hospital located 40 miles North of New York City which serves Fairfield County and Westchester County. GH is an academic affiliate of Yale University School of Medicine and a member of the Yale New Haven Health System.
The GH Stoke Center has a comprehensive stroke program and 24/7 neuro-interventionalists. We read studies from 4 CTs, one PET/CT, and 3 MRIs (two 1.5T and one 3.0T) with a volume of approximately 30,000 CT and 11,000 MRI studies per year. We also have a long-standing contract with a local orthopedic-neurosurgeon group and interpret all MRIs performed on their two 1.5T magnets.
The GH Breast Center is nationally accredited and an ACR center of excellence. There are two onsite full-time breast surgeons and a comprehensive staff to support patients through treatment. We read approximately 17,000 mammograms a year. We also perform screening breast ultrasound, breast mri, mri and stereotactic biopsy, ultrasound guided procedures, and needle localizations both conventional and savi scout. Strong interpersonal skills are a must as we are a high touch practice centered on the patient experience with high patient satisfaction scores.
Employee breast/body positions could be 3 or 4 days a week and would include some assigned plain films and/or CT cases including ER coverage if desired.
The partnership track position for neuro/general or breast/body could be 4-5 days a week and requires participation in the diagnostic call responsibilities at a frequency equal to other full-time shareholders. The group covers overnight and weekend diagnostic radiology remotely after 5PM, but contracts with a teleradiology group to cover from 10:00 PM to 7:30 AM including on weekends. The group has members who take IR call and perform IR procedures.
We are vital group that has served Greenwich since 1957 and enjoys a strong relationship with Greenwich Hospital. We offer a competitive compensation/benefits package.
